 Prop recommendation
I am putting a new prop on the motor I just bought (MB 29 hp longtail). Which is a better prop, the mud buddy big blade? Or backwater? Whichever prop I go with, it will be a 9x7. The motor will be on an 18x44 go devil and I usually hunt with 2 guys, a dog and about 4 dozen decoys, so a normal 2 man hunting load.

I don't know about Mud Buddy specifically, but I know some prop manufacturers do not balance check their props. So then you have a chance of getting a prop that is not truly balanced. Back Water checks each prop individually to guarantee they are properly balanced.
